#aed3ee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aed3ee is composed of 68.2% red, 82.7%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.9% cyan, 11.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 205.3 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 80.8%. #aed3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5da7dd.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#aed3ee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#aed3ee has RGB values of R:174, G:211,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 11457518.

Hex triplet aed3ee #aed3ee
RGB Decimal 174, 211, 238 rgb(174,211,238)
RGB Percent 68.2, 82.7, 93.3 rgb(68.2%,82.7%,93.3%)
CMYK 27, 11, 0, 7
HSL 205.3°, 65.3, 80.8 hsl(205.3,65.3%,80.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 205.3°, 26.9, 93.3
Web Safe 99ccff #99ccff
CIE-LAB 82.785, -6.184, -17.27
XYZ 56.179, 61.759, 89.845
xyY 0.27, 0.297, 61.759
CIE-LCH 82.785, 18.344, 250.298
CIE-LUV 82.785, -19.767, -26.278
Hunter-Lab 78.587, -9.923, -12.773
Binary 10101110, 11010011, 11101110

Shades and Tints of #aed3ee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eff6fc is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#aed3ee is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#cbcbcb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c5cdd2 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#cbcfeb Protanopia 1% of men
  • #d2ccf2 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#afd6e6 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#c0d0ec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c5cef0 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#afd5e9 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
